Banana Ice Cream is a hybrid perfectly balanced, with 50% Indica and 50% Sativa, combining the best of both worlds. In just 8 to 9 weeks, it offers a harvest of between 450 and 550 grams per square meter indoors, or up to 450 grams per plant outdoors. This variety adapts perfectly to cool climates, showing its robustness and versatility. With a THC ranging between 18% and 24%, provides you with a powerful experience that mixes deep relaxation with stimulating effects on appetite, as well as relief from pain and anxiety. Its tropical and fruity flavor profile, with a touch of banana and earthy nuances, makes it a delicious and effective option for any need.
Flower appearance. The buds are large, dense and compact, with a robust structure that ensures excellent production. The deep green of the buds is mixed with hints of orange and purple, creating a vibrant color palette. A generous layer of resinous trichomes gives them a golden shine that underlines their potency. When breaking the buds, a sweet and tropical aroma is released, reminiscent of ripe bananas, complemented by earthy and floral nuances that enrich the sensory experience.
Plant Morphology. Banana Ice Cream is developed in a plant with a balanced structure and moderate height. Indoors, it reaches between 90 and 120 cm, and outdoors it can reach 150-180 cm. With a leafy shape and strong branches, the plant holds its buds well, even in tight spaces. Its wide, green leaves contrast with the bright colors of the buds, and its adaptability to cool climates makes it ideal for various growing environments.
Growing Tips
- Ideal weather. Banana Ice Cream prefers cool climates. Maintain temperatures between 18-22°C (65-72°F) during the day, and a little cooler at night. Make sure you have good ventilation to avoid moisture and mold problems, especially indoors.
- Space and Training. Although it is of moderate size, using training techniques such as LST (Low Stress Training) can be very beneficial. This promotes uniform growth and maximizes bud exposure to light, helping to keep the plant manageable and improving performance in small spaces.
- Nutrients and Fertilization. During the vegetative phase, use fertilizers balanced in nitrogen, phosphorus and potassium (NPK) for robust growth. As flowering begins, switch to fertilizers high in phosphorus and potassium to promote dense, resinous buds. Avoid overfertilization to avoid causing leaf burn problems.
- Irrigation and Humidity. Banana Ice Cream prefers moderate watering. Let the top layer of soil dry between watering to prevent waterlogging. Maintain relative humidity between 40-50% during flowering to prevent mold on the buds.
- Pruning and Management. Pruning is essential for good air circulation and light penetration. Remove lower branches and large leaves that block light to improve the formation of high quality buds. Prune gradually to minimize stress, and consider removing light-blocking leaves to maximize the yield of top buds.
